Tex. Loc. Gov't Code § 51.032

ORDINANCES AND BYLAWS

Acts 1987, 70th Leg., ch. 149, Sec. 1, eff

(a) The governing body of the municipality may adopt an ordinance or bylaw, not inconsistent with state law, that the governing body considers proper for the government of the municipal corporation.

(b) The governing body may take any other action necessary to carry out a provision of this code applicable to the municipality.
